A fine illustrated Italian sixteenth-century work on fortification and military architecture
BUSCA, GABRIELLO
Della espugnatione et difesa delle fortezze, libri due. Turin: heirs of Nicolò Bevilacqua, 1585. First edition. Modern vellum. 9 1/2 x 7 1/8 inches (24.25 x 18 cm); [8], 256, [3] pp., 10 double-page woodcuts of military operations, woodcut arms of Savoy on title, historiated woodcut initials. Repairs to inner margin of first and last 2 leaves, some light staining, generally an attractive copy, with the H.P. Kraus label.
First edition of a fine illustrated Italian sixteenth-century work on fortification and military architecture. Gabriello Busca (circa. 1540-1619) had been in the service of the Duke of Savoy since 1570, and he was the first to discuss the proportions and functions of the different parts of a military front. Adams B-3333; Ayala, no. 89; Cockle 785; Ind. Aur. 128.115; Riccardi I, 204, no. 2a.
